7-Day Morocco Highlights (Casablanca to Marrakech)
The Route: Casablanca → Chefchaouen → Fes → Merzouga (Sahara) → Dades Valley → Marrakech
Day 1: Casablanca to Chefchaouen — Tour Hassan II Mosque, then drive north into the Rif Mountains for your overnight stay.
Day 2: Chefchaouen to Fes — Morning exploring the blue streets and Spanish Mosque viewpoint; afternoon transfer to Fes.
Day 3: Fes to Sahara Desert (Merzouga) — Express morning tour of Fes medina (tanneries), drive through Middle Atlas forests, sunset camel trek into Erg Chebbi dunes.
Day 4: Sahara Desert to Dades Valley — Sunrise over the dunes, walk through Todra Gorge cliffs, overnight in the Dades gorges.
Day 5: Dades Valley to Marrakech — Visit UNESCO kasbah Ait Benhaddou, drive across the High Atlas Mountains via Tizi n'Tichka pass.
Day 6: Marrakech Exploration — Full day in the medina: Bahia Palace, souks, and evening at Jemaa el-Fnaa square.
Day 7: Marrakech Departure — Morning at Majorelle Garden & airport transfer.
7-Day Morocco Tour Itinerary
Day 1 – Casablanca – Rabat – Chefchaouen
Arrive in Casablanca and meet your private driver. Visit the impressive Hassan II Mosque, then continue to Rabat, Morocco’s capital. Explore the Hassan Tower, Mohammed V Mausoleum and Kasbah of the Udayas before driving north to the beautiful Blue City of Chefchaouen. Enjoy an evening walk through the blue-painted medina.
Overnight: Chefchaouen
Day 2 – Chefchaouen – Volubilis – Fes
Enjoy a morning in Chefchaouen to explore its charming blue streets, local shops and viewpoints. Continue to the ancient Roman ruins of Volubilis, where you can discover remarkably preserved mosaics and Roman architecture. Continue to Fes for the evening.
Overnight: Fes
Day 3 – Fes Guided Tour
Spend the day discovering the cultural and historical heart of Morocco. Explore the Fes Medina, one of the largest medieval medinas in the world, including the Bou Inania Madrasa, Al Quaraouiyine area, Nejjarine Fountain, souks and traditional tanneries. Enjoy the atmosphere of this fascinating imperial city.
Overnight: Fes
Day 4 – Fes – Ifrane – Cedar Forest – Midelt – Ziz Valley – Merzouga
Depart Fes and travel through the Middle Atlas Mountains. Stop in Ifrane, known for its European-style architecture, then continue through the Cedar Forest, home to Barbary macaques. Drive through Midelt and enjoy spectacular scenery along the Ziz Valley before reaching Merzouga and the Sahara Desert.
Overnight: Merzouga Desert Camp
Day 5 – Merzouga – Rissani – Erfoud – Todra Gorges – Dades Valley
Wake up to the sunrise over the Sahara before continuing to Rissani, famous for its traditional market and historic atmosphere. Travel through Erfoud and the dramatic landscapes of the desert region before reaching the spectacular Todra Gorges. Continue through the Valley of the Roses toward the beautiful Dades Valley.
Overnight: Dades Valley
Day 6 – Dades Valley – Ait Ben Haddou – Ouarzazate – High Atlas – Marrakech
After breakfast, drive through the spectacular landscapes of southern Morocco. Visit Ait Ben Haddou, the famous fortified ksar and UNESCO World Heritage Site. Continue to Ouarzazate before crossing the High Atlas Mountains via the Tizi n’Tichka pass. Arrive in Marrakech in the late afternoon and enjoy your first evening in the Red City.
Overnight: Marrakech
Day 7 – Marrakech – Casablanca
Enjoy some free time in Marrakech in the morning, with the opportunity to explore the famous Jemaa el-Fna square, souks and medina. Later, depart for Casablanca, where your 7-day Morocco journey comes to an end.
